Primera Participates in the 2024 J.P. Morgan Corporate Challenge

Yesterday, thousands of runners from hundreds of companies filled the streets of downtown Chicago for the 41st Annual J.P. Morgan Corporate Challenge, the world’s largest corporate running event. Over 12,000 participants gathered near Chicago’s Grant Park for the friendly competition that concluded with a post-event celebration over food and drinks. More than 25 Primera employees joined the large crowd to test their speed and endurance throughout the 3.5-mile course. We’re happy to report that our team average finish time was 40:53, ranking in number 227 out of 426 local companies representing all industries.

This year, J.P. Morgan Chase proudly supported Hope Chicago. The organization is a multigenerational economic mobility initiative focused on enhancing the future of Chicago’s students, families, and communities through debt-free higher education completion. Launched in 2021, Hope Chicago’s model supports postsecondary pathways offering full financial coverage and wraparound services to graduates and their parents from five community high schools on Chicago’s South and West Sides—providing families the opportunity to reach their fullest potential. To date, Hope Chicago’s efforts have increased postsecondary enrollment at its five partner high schools by 30%—enrolling over 1,200 Hope Scholars in Illinois-based partner institutions. Globally, the J.P. Morgan Corporate Challenge series attracts more than 35,000 runners and walkers from over 1,000 companies. Each year, these events take place in 16 locations across eight countries and six continents with one mission: to serve as a catalyst between work and wellness. Primera has been participating in the series for over ten years thanks to coordination efforts from our Wellness Committee.
